I am delighted that Statoil has kindly offered to host a Gurteen Knowledge Cafe in Stavanger, Norway on the evening of 22nd May. The event is free and runs from 6:30pm until about 9:00 pm. Drinks and light refreshments will be provided.
Date: Tuesday 22nd May 2007 6:30pm - 9:00pm. Please arrive at 6:30pm or shortly after which will give you time to settle in and meet other people. Drinks and light refreshments will be available. The cafe itself will start at 7:00pm. Host: Statoil Location Address The Cardinal Pub Skagen 21, 4006 Stavanger Norway Map and directions: http://www.stavangertravel.com/eatdrink/cardinal-pub-stavanger.cfm Room: The Bar Theme: The Gurteen Knowledge Cafe This is the first time I have run a Gurteen Knowledge Cafe in Norway and so I will start by explaining the history of the cafes; their purpose; their benefits and the process by which they are run. We will then move on to run a Knowledge Cafe on a theme that we have yet to have chosen but it may be something like "What are the barriers to knowledge sharing within organizations and how do we overcome them?" which is a theme I often use and generates a great deal of interesting and insightful conversation. I have run 100s of knowledge cafes over the last few years and they are really great learning and networking events. Everyone engages with the theme of the cafe and some tremendous insightful, energetic conversations take place. If you can make it - please do come along. You will not be disappointed. Better still the cafe format is one that you can take back with you and use in your own organizations to help create a more innovative culture.
